Graduation Cap & Diploma Sugar Cookies

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all purpose flour (plus more if needed)
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 cup butter (softened slightly)
  • 3/4 cups s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 3/4 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
  • 1/2 teaspoon almond extract
  • 16 ounces white chocolate
  • 1/3 cup light corn syrup (plus more if needed)
  • food coloring (flesh tone and other color for your grad caps)

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it.
  2. Mix flour, salt, and baking powder in a bowl and set aside.
  3. Cream the but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
  4. Stir in the egg, vanilla, and almond extract.
  5. Gradually add d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
  6. If the dough is sticky, add a bit of flour.
  7. Roll out the dough on a floured surface to about 1/8 inch thick.
  8. Cut out twelve 3-inch circles and diamond-shaped grad caps from the dough.
  9. Cut a triangle-shaped notch out of each circle for the grad cap.
  10. Press the diamond-shaped dough into the notch and seal the edges with your fingers.
  11. Bake for 10-14 minutes until edges are set and tops look dry.
  12. Allow cookies to cool completely before decorating.
  13. Reserve 2 tablespoons of white modeling chocolate for tassels, and color the rest for the caps.
  14. Roll out flesh-tone chocolate to about 1/16 inch and cut into 3-inch circles.
  15. Roll out the colored chocolate similarly and cut out 12 diamond-shaped grad caps.
  16. Use the notch cutter on each circle and brush with corn syrup before layering the chocolates.
  17. Roll modeling chocolate for tassels and form the strands as directed. Brush dot of corn syrup to attach strands to the caps and shapes as needed.

Notes

Ensure the modeling chocolate rests before using for best consistency.
For a unique touch, mix various food coloring shades.
Store cookies in an airtight container to maintain freshness.
